How to manage all your Wifi connections with multiWifi for Android

MultiWIFI main features

  • Wifi signal scan to check in which part of your house the signal arrives with greater strength and therefore better reception quality.
  • Wifi password generator, a utility that creates complicated passwords for us so that our Wi-Fi connection is as secure and impenetrable as possible.
  • Make BackUps of all the passwords stored in the history of your Android. This option is only available for users ROOT.
  • Recover BackUps.
  • Network scanner To recover default passwords in the main routers on the market, this option will also be useful to see if our Wi-Fi network is considered safe or insecure.

The last option for scanning Wi-Fi networks is capable of recovering the Wi-Fi key of origin of connections of the type JAZZTEL_XXXX, WLAN_XXXX and various models of Thomson routers, yes, as long as they remain with the keys that came from the factory by default.
